A limit on top quark pair production at future electron-proton colliders
Abstract
The ratio of the structure functions for deep inelastic scattering in top pair production at future electron-proton colliders is analyzed at a fixed $\sqrt{s}$ and $Q^2$ relative to the minimum value of $x$ given by $Q^2/s$ using collinear factorization. This compact formula for the ratio $F_{L2}(Q^2/s,Q^2,m_{t})$ is useful for extracting a bound on the top structure function. The reduced cross-section for top production at this limit is determined, establishing a bound value for $t\overline{t}$ production at the LHeC and FCC-eh center-of-mass energies based on renormalization scales. The modification of the Bjorken scaling is applied to this bound of the reduced top cross-section at the renormalization scale $\mu^2=Q^2+4m_{t}^{2}$, which improves the scaling quantity at $Q^2{<}4m_{t}^{2}$. The dipole cross-section for top pair production is examined across a wide range of dipole sizes, denoted as $r$. It is expected that there will be limited behavior in observing top saturation in future electron-proton colliders according to the bound behavior. The probability of the Higgs boson in $\gamma^{*}g$ interactions is compared to the $gg$ process at the order of $\mathcal{O}(\alpha^{\mathrm{em}}/\alpha_{s})$.
